- Prime Minister Sir Keir Starmer is prepared to support a peace deal in Ukraine without a prior ceasefire, Downing Street has indicated.
- The UK government's updated position prioritises ending the conflict over an immediate ceasefire, aligning with Russian President Vladimir Putin's approach.
- This stance follows a summit between Mr Putin and US President Donald Trump, where Mr Trump reportedly dropped demands for an immediate ceasefire.
- The UK has stressed that international borders must not be changed by force, after Mr Trump floated the possibility of Ukraine ceding territory.
- Sir Keir will meet with Mr Trump and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ky in Washington DC to discuss peace efforts.
